Dorothy West was an American novelist and short story writer associated with the Harlem Renaissance. Born on June 2, 1907 in Massachusetts, she published works such as The Living Is Easy (1948) and The Richer, The Poorer: Stories, Sketches, and Reminiscences (1995). Her 1995 work, The Wedding, was adapted into a television miniseries by Oprah Winfrey.

Before Fame

She began writing at the age of seven; by her mid-teens, she had won several literary contests.

Trivia

She died at the age of ninety-one.

Family Life

Her father, Isaac Christopher West, was a slave for part of his life.

Associated With

She tied with Zora Neale Hurston in a 1926 short story contest.
